The more I fish for The White Perch, the more bream I catch on jigs. About to go camping for 4 days at a bream wonderland with the moon nearly perfect. If I find them, and I will find them, is there really a reason to fool with crickets? Maybe downsize my crappie jigs?

you can catch a bunch of bream on one Gulp cricket and you don't have to worry about them dying.
I don't have bait stores anywhere around me and I keep a pretty good supply of them so I can go fishing on a whim.

Fishing for bream with a fly rod is a ton of fun. Also, you get the random bass and catfish too. A good sized catfish on a fly rod can fill up a few minutes of time.
Posted on 5/20/13 at 3:29 pm to TigerDeacon
I have a 2wt flyrod that I pretty much only use for bream fishing. I've hooked a few bass upwards of 2 lbs on it. A 2lbs bass on a 2wt is something everyone needs to experience once. It's a 5-10minute ordeal and they feel more like a 20lbs bullred than a 2lbs bass.
